About Mahan Mathur

Mahan Mathur is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ging, Rheumatology and Infectious Diseases, having authored 32 papers that have together received 462 indexed citations. Recurring topics across this work include Urologic and reproductive health conditions (4 papers), Genital Health and Disease (4 papers), Radiology practices and education (3 papers), Renal and Vascular Pathologies (3 papers), MRI in cancer diagnosis (2 papers), Urological Disorders and Treatments (2 papers), Renal Transplantation Outcomes and Treatments (2 papers) and Prostate Cancer Diagnosis and Treatment (2 papers). The work is most often cited by research in Reproductive Medicine (64 citations), Microbiology (26 citations), Obstetrics and Gynecology (28 citations), Microbiology (3 citations) and Pulmonary and Respiratory Medicine (118 citations). Mahan Mathur has collaborated with scholars based in United States, Germany and France. Frequent co-authors include Jeffrey C. Weinreb, Lina Irshaid, Michael Spektor, G Sze, Carl E. Johnson, Gary M. Israel, Amir H. Davarpanah, Khalid Al‐Dasuqi, Leslie M. Scoutt and Marc Ferrante. Their work appears in journals such as Abdominal Radiology, Radiographics, Journal of the American College of Radiology, Radiology and Obstetrics and Gynecology Clinics of North America.
